Amazon announced this morning that at the end of this summer it will open its new robotic logistics center in Seville, which according to the company will be equipped with cutting-edge technology.
With this new center, located in the Dos Hermanas Megapark business park , just 14 kilometers from Seville, Amazon will create more than 1,000 permanent jobs in three years, which will be added to the 7,000 jobs of these characteristics that the multinational already maintains in Spain.
Amazon will soon begin hiring for this logistics center, whose positions will range from operations managers, through engineers, IT, human resources or personnel to handle customer orders.

Labor conditions

The hiring of warehouse employees , which will include the Most of the staff of this center will start gradually in the coming weeks.
“All these personnel will be hired under the Collective Agreement of Logistics Operators of the Province of Seville, with a base salary of more than 14,500 euros gross and an extensive package of benefits,” they assured from Amazon.
This package includes private medical insurance, life insurance, employee discount and a company pension plan.
“The entire compensation package is at the highest range in the logistics sector,” they assured.
Those selected may also benefit from a training plan . “Employees will also benefit from the innovative program called Career Choice, which finances its employees 95% of enrollment and other fees, up to 8,000 euros over four years, for nationally approved courses,” they explained.

State-of-the -art facilities

The new logistics center, covering nearly 200,000 square meters, will also be equipped with the advanced technology of Amazon Robotics , focused on the safety and well-being of employees.
“This technology is part of the innovations that Amazon has introduced to support the employees of the logistics centers, since it reduces the time spent traveling, by making the shelves come to them,” they indicated from the US multinational.
The new logistics center will have integrated energy saving technology, which will help reduce the CO2 footprint.
Likewise, it will have solar panels on the roof and low energy consumption systems, “such as the use of LEDs, which will provide excellent lighting for employees.”
The ventilation systems will include heat and energy recovery technology, and the windows, roof and facades will have high thermal efficiency to guarantee insulation.
Finally, outside the building, landscaping will be carried out to maintain the balance of the area’s biodiversity.

Commitment to Spain

“We are proud to expand our network of operations with this new logistics center in Seville, equipped with the latest generation of robotic technology,” said Roy Perticucci , vice president of Customer Fulfilment for Amazon in Europe.
“Since we started our business activities in Spain in 2011, we have invested more than €2.9 billion in infrastructure and facilities, transport and shipping, as well as salaries and benefits for our employees. In addition, we have also committed to investing in renewable energy. as a critical step to combat our global carbon footprint,” added the company executive.
The Seville facilities will be Amazon’s fourth automated center in Spain , as it will join those in El Prat and Castellbisbal, and a automated distribution center in Barbera del Valles.
This new center will be used by the company to store, prepare and manage products and support Amazon operations in Spain and throughout Europe.
The company has invested 2,900 million euros in Spain between 2011 and 2018 in infrastructure, shipments, salaries and benefits for employees.
The investments made also include two software development centers in Madrid and Barcelona which, at the end of 2019, employed around 300 engineers, software developers, data scientists, machine learning experts and cloud experts.
